National Security and Defence Council Director General Timoci Natuva has highlighted that with satellite technology, Fiji will be able to get real time imagery of troops on the ground.

While making their submissions to the Standing Committee on Foreign Affairs on the Ministry of Defense and National Security 2016 Bi-Annual Report, Natuva revealed that this kind of technology would have been a great help to Fiji during the capturing of Fijian troops in 2017.

Natuva says the system can also be used to give Fiji imagery of our coral reefs for the past 20 years.

Natuva revealed that the sharing of information between the Ministry and the Fiji Police Force is also done more effectively now.

He says this was made possible after the recruitment of 24 staff members who are from the Navy, the police force as well as from the army.
